Once subject to UDRP and ACPA battles NewportNews.com expires

NewportNews.com is a domain name that has quite the history. A former owner once defended a UDRP successfully but then lost an ACPA case. This led Michael Berkens to call this registrant stupid domainer of the year for 2011.
